Working at Messick's
Messick's has been a family business ever since brothers Marlin and Merville Messick started the dealership in 1952. Over the years we've grown from a two-person operation to a company of over 220 people staffing five locations in south central Pennsylvania. Messick's remains a family business, operated by Merville's sons Bob and Ken and their children. We are a company dedicated to providing exceptional parts, service and sales support to our customers.
Messick's offers industry leading wages, 401k, paid vacation, health insurance and a Christ centered work environment. We strive to offer the best in customer service and believe it takes exceptional staff to deliver that promise.
